Where to Use It Carefully
While this asset is visually rich, it’s not a one-size-fits-all solution. Use it thoughtfully in:
- Small Mobile Thumbnails: The detail may get lost at very small sizes.
- Text-Heavy Blog Images: Could compete with headline copy if not balanced properly.
- Low-Contrast Backgrounds: May not pop enough if not placed on a complementary background.
- Busy Layouts: Can add visual clutter if not used as a focal point.
- Corporate or Minimalist Niches: May feel out of place in more formal or minimalist design systems.
Publisher Notes: Practical Tips for Real-World Use
Before deploying the Girl and Cat 3D Shadow Box SVG across your content ecosystem, here are some practical steps to ensure it enhances—not hinders—your publishing goals:
- Test on Desktop and Mobile: Confirm it looks sharp and recognizable on all screen sizes.
- Preview as a Thumbnail: See how it performs in small image grids or Pinterest feeds.
- Place in Real Blog Layouts: Embed it into your CMS or page builder to evaluate how it interacts with text and other elements.
- Test with Headline Text: Ensure it doesn’t overpower or clash with your typography.
- Check Contrast and Readability: Try it on different background colors and with various font styles (serif, sans-serif, script, etc.).
- Try in Black and White: See if it still works in grayscale for accessibility or print use.
- Review File Size: Optimize the SVG, PNG, or PDF for fast loading, especially if used in multiple places across a site.
- Verify Licensing: Make sure it includes a commercial license for use in monetized content, affiliate marketing, or digital products.
What You Actually Get: Design Files for Real Publishers
The Girl and Cat 3D Shadow Box SVG comes with a versatile set of file types: SVG for digital use, AI and EPS for vector editing, high-quality PNG for web publishing, PDF for print, and DXF for cutting machines. This variety makes it suitable not only for bloggers and digital marketers but also for small business owners creating physical products or printables. Whether you're building a Canva template library or designing a digital guide, you'll find a format that fits your workflow.
